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
24 3229 4491 191 332
2673516415 73 2730420
2673516415 73 2730420
80076624 419618735 98
All about undefined
Interested in learning more?
2673516415 73 2730420
80076624 419618735 98
See more
47663095 026
36764382563 024968586 33
See more
93888 5548 1482438894
470 437682 38 68703637 6287118886
See more